Does the final departure of the dog hurt?

Undoubtedly, when the time comes for the "friend" to leave or, in other words, to die, that generates pain and frustration, generates momentary anger, incomprehension before the case, that irreparable loss leaves a great void, and when it comes to children, sometimes they are the most affected psychologically, although adults are also touched with that loss.

Children sometimes find it more difficult to understand that the dog has a life cycle and that he will also die once that time is up, that is when we must appeal to adult creativity and make him see the separation of his best friend, his playmate, as natural as possible.

It is understandable that we also want to replace the one who left with another quickly, and we look for another puppy believing that with this we alleviate that pain, it could be true in some cases, as long as that new member fills the void left, that is, That this new dog does the same or almost the same thing as the other dog, otherwise it could generate frustration and disappointment.

But also older adults also suffer from the loss of their partner for a few years, they too become fond of their "friend" and when the disappearance occurs they become sad and depressed.

Within the range of ways of how the loss of your friend is generated, it will also depend how do you react and how it is assumed.

I will explain, if the loss occurs naturally, that is, the dog was already very old, it is undoubted that at any moment death would come, in this way pain is assumed with less intensity; On the contrary, if death occurs untimely, tragic or due to an accident, it will cause much more pain and depression; Another case is if death occurs as a result of a disease for which it could not be avoided, because the medications did not work or because it is an incurable disease, perhaps we prepare with resignation and we assume that this would come quickly and could even relieve us pain if we know and know about the suffering of the animal and we understand that this was the best thing in that circumstance.

In such a way we must understand that animals, like humans, have a lifespan and that after that time the final disappearance is presented, the goodbye forever.
